Richard Bultitude has been appointed as a
manager in Baker Tilly’s forensic services team in London.
Bultitude was previously a forensic technology
manager at KPMG, where he was responsible for the scoping and
management of large and complex data collection exercises.
Bultitude also specialised in computer forensic investigations
undertaken by the team.
At Baker Tilly, Bultitude will be responsible
for providing computer forensics advice to law firms and other
corporate organisations.
Baker Tilly Forensic Services team partner
Marcus McCaffrey said that as fraud cases become increasingly
complex and information footprints take greater skill in tracing
through the transaction routes, the need for excellent computer
forensics is a prerequisite.
“Bultitude’s specialist skills will complement
our existing forensic offering and will further help meet the needs
of our clients,” McCaffrey said.
